Transaction 66d2b4ba463aff58ebe9d6e37ecc664481b833670052a15e1619d8624839dbf0
1 Input
2 Outputs
- 66d2b4ba463aff58ebe9d6e37ecc664481b833670052a15e1619d8624839dbf0:0
- 66d2b4ba463aff58ebe9d6e37ecc664481b833670052a15e1619d8624839dbf0:1
value 48456500
address 1Mm1Zt9cGcxe79D71otLyQgAGywwLhCAbm
value 96760516
address 18iXrPmyuN7Q3FvrKrsR1AbrWtSe8ooUEN